Default How can you display the path of the file in the title bar of Word

Using Office 2003, want to display the Filename and path in the title bar.
(Like is done in WordPerfect)

One solution, using macros, is shown at
http://gregmaxey.mvps.org/File_Name_And_Path.htm.

Another solution is to display the Web toolbar, and hold down the Ctrl and
Alt keys while you drag a copy of the address box from the toolbar to the
blank area of the menu bar to the right of the Help menu item. It always
shows the complete path of the current active document, plus it's scrollable
and copyable.
